Strengthening China-ASEAN Agricultural Cooperation
China is Cambodia’s largest trading partner and a major market for its agricultural exports. The Kampong Thom SEZ is likely to attract Chinese investment and technology, especially in areas such as rice milling, cashew nut processing, and tropical fruit preservation. Under the China-Cambodia Free Trade Agreement and the broader RCEP framework, processed agricultural products from the SEZ can enter China with preferential tariffs, enhancing market access.
Implications for Regional Investment PatternsThe project signals a broader trend across ASEAN: the shift from primary production to value-added manufacturing. As labor costs rise in more developed ASEAN economies, countries like Cambodia, Myanmar, and Laos are positioning themselves as agro-processing hubs. The Kampong Thom SEZ could serve as a model for other provinces, encouraging further investment in cold chains, quality control, and food safety standards.
From an investor perspective, the SEZ offers a concentrated environment with streamlined regulatory processes, utility infrastructure, and potential tax incentives under Cambodia’s Investment Law. This reduces the risk and complexity of setting up processing facilities in rural areas.
